Shelly L Howell
Lompoc, CA- Lompoc, CA + 1 more
More about Shelly L Howell
Summary
- Full Name
- Shelly L Howell
- Used to Live in:
Phones and Addresses
-
Lompoc, CA
-
Lompoc, CA1212 Village Meadows Dr Lompoc, CA 93436